Challenge
A global stock media brand was performing a security audit focused on AI risk. In the course of this audit, they discovered a serious problem: no one could tell them how to verify their controls. Vendors crowded around every side to reassure them they could provide the silver bullet tool, but no one could offer proof that those tools were working. Unless and until an AI-related incident occurred, it seemed, they were expected to take it all on faith. Being serious about their security, the client wasn’t willing to trust without verification.
Solution
We identified several major opportunities for no-cost improvements to the client’s security infrastructure, along with recommendations around strategic planning. We identified valuable unimplemented controls around API usage, found high-value logs not captured in alerts, helped senior leaders design and push a new DLP implementation, and worked with their engineers to validate an enterprise browser to upgrade and uniformly enforce security. The detailed, prioritized recommendations allowed the client to make strategic, defensible decisions around AI risk and to rapidly upgrade their resilience against it.
Best of all, we tied every single test and recommendation back to major AI frameworks (e.g., MITRE ATLAS, NIST SP 800-171, MAESTRO) to make it all fit smoothly into their audit.
